Cascade Township, Dubuque County, Iowa

Cascade Township is one of seventeen townships in Dubuque County, Iowa, United States.

As of the 2000 census, its population was 1,079.

[1] The name of Cascade Township is derived from the cascade, or water power, with which early settlers powered their mills.

[2] According to the United States Census Bureau, Cascade Township covers an area of 35.78 square miles (92.68 square kilometers).

The township contains these five cemeteries: Cascade Protestant, Johns Creek, Saint Martins Catholic, Saint Marys Catholic and Zion Reform.
